Dorset Street is in Cardiff and in Cardiff district. CF11 6PS is located in the Grangetown elect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Cardiff South and Penarth. This postcode has been in use since 1999-06-01.

Safety

Is Dorset Street dangerous?

In 2023, 916 crimes were reported near Dorset Street . Only 9%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ered dangerous.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of CF11 6PS.
